This made-for-cable TV film is based on a real event that is often considered to have been the most intense shootout in Los Angeles Police history. On February 28, 1997, two bank robbers–who were known as "The High Incident Bandits" due to their crime spree–attempted to rob a bank in North Hollywood. The heavily armed pair kept numerous police and S.W.A.T. team members at bay for 44 minutes. This film recreates (with some fictionalization) that event. 1 User Review

William Campbell (James Earl Jones) promised his wife (Lynne Moody) on her deathbed that he would open a reading room in their inner-city neighborhood to help teach illiterate neighbors how to read. He opens the reading room, but almost insurmountable problems arise and threaten his efforts to help the neighborhood. 2 User Reviews

Carlos (Douglas Spain) has dreams of becoming a success as a Hollywood star, but his father Pepe (Efrain Figueroa) expects Carlos to become part of the family business of male prostitution. Carlos decides to be one of his father's "boys" until his moment for stardom occurs. When the moment arrives, the realities of life take their toll.
